Q: Is 2,956,620 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,956,620 is a composite number.

Why is 2,956,620 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,956,620 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 30 60 49,277 98,554 147,831 197,108 246,385 295,662 492,770 591,324 739,155 985,540 1,478,310 and 2,956,620, with no remainder.

Since 2,956,620 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,956,620, it is a composite number.
